HiFi Reviews?
I've spent a couple days searching the forum on this topic and I don't want to boil anyone's blood.
That being said, have any of you come across an actual review of the base system in the M3? My local dealers suck and don't have any M cars anyway, so I don't have the opportunity to listen to either one. I understand the EPS is better, as it should be. But I didn't order it and I had to make a decision in the blind on this option. This M is also my first BMW so I don't have any context with the brand. It 's probably not too late to add the option since my VIN isn't assigned yet but I'm not sure it's worth the trouble. I'm really just looking for an evaluation of the HiFi system on it's own merit, not a comparison to the EPS. Obviously, the 2k price matters to me since I'm trying to keep the total cost down to my budget. That particular option fell bellow my cutoff line initially but I don't want any regrets for prioritizing it too low. Sorry I got tired of all the searching and finally had to ask the question! Thanks for the help! |

You do get the tweeters in the front door sails along with the subwoofers in under the seats. The 2010+ M3s lose the rear tweeters in the back seats, but I don't feel this is an issue as highs are directional while bass under 100-150hz is non directional so all in all its not bad. I wouldn't spend $2k for the EPS as most of the time in my M3 I'm listening to the engine/exhaust note as my engine combination sounds devine. Dave

One thing that no forum member have tried but it is more than possible is to order a Harman Kardon system in their USA M3. For $875 it is a much better value than the EPS and really improves quite a bit on the HiFi. That could be done thru Individual. Somebody like Ryan Amico could make it happen. |
